Output eea0500651e207a134923b466fed250df1d3e1c51c8e5722a6780f9b25177daf:0

value
20894094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3918864c85bcbe40c36e26e7fa43d03e709002e1 OP_EQUALVERIFY OP_CHECKSIG
address
16CttwAD9RfPD8eKRhTucrT1CEt6BYNGMS
transaction
eea0500651e207a134923b466fed250df1d3e1c51c8e5722a6780f9b25177daf
spent
true